Muellering along, exploited cell phone GPS to track Trump associates
[WashingtonTimes] Uranium One Robert Mueller says he was able to pinpoint security company executive Erik Prince's precise location for several hours in January 2017 by matching his mobile phone signal to a cell site near Trump Tower in New York City.

The special counsel's report discloses the use of this investigative technique, by which police determine a suspect';s location via a cell phone GPS signal.

The Prince narrative is one instance in unredacted sections of the report in which Mr. Mueller's team explicitly disclosed cell phone tracking. It raises the question of whether the FBI applied the process to other victims investigative subjects a phone's GPS signal can disclose its exact location within a few feet. One of the first requests the FBI makes when confronting subjects is to ask for their electronic devices.

The fact Mr. Mueller could pinpoint Mr. Prince's exact whereabouts suggest he used GPS readouts, which prosecutors can subpoena from cellular service providers.
